Dani Alves found guilty of rape, faces 4+ years in jail
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

A court in Spain has found former Brazil national team player, Dani Alves guilty of raping a woman in a nightclub situated in Barcelona.

The 40-year-old in pre-trial detention since January 2023, had denied sexually assaulting the woman in the early hours of December 31, 2022.

The prosecution had asked for a nine-year prison sentence. In Spain, a claim of rape is investigated under the general accusation of sexual assault, and convictions can lead to prison sentences of four to 15 years.

Despite requests made for his acquittal by his lawyer, Spanish media reports that the court took into account Alves’ decision to pay the victim €150,000 in damages no matter the outcome of the trial.

The court did not, however, accept the argument put forward by his lawyers that he should be given a more lenient sentence because he was drunk.
